3.4 USB-I2C Bridge
The PSoC 5LP also functions as a USB-I2C bridge. The PSoC 4 communicates with the PSoC 5LP
using an I2C interface and the PSoC 5LP transfers the data over the USB to the USB-I2C software
utility on the PC, called the Bridge Control Panel (BCP).
The BCP is available as part of the PSoC Programmer installation. This software can be used to
send and receive USB-I2C data from the PSoC 5LP. When the USB mini-B cable is connected to
header J10 on the Pioneer Kit, the KitProg USB-I2C is available under Connected I2C/SPI/RX8
Ports in the BCP.

To use the USB_I2C functionality, select the KitProg USB-I2C in the BCP. On successful
connection, the Connected and Powered tabs turn green.
